Executive Summary of the 2024 Philippine Clinical Practice Guidelines on the Diagnosis and Management of Acute Severe Blood Pressure Elevation

open access: yesThe Journal of Clinical Hypertension, Volume 28, Issue 2, February 2026.
ABSTRACT A recent survey in the Philippines, PRESYON‐4, showed increasing prevalence of hypertension from 22% in the 1990s to 37% in 2021, of which only 52% were aware of their diagnosis. While rates of treatment and adherence were 68% and 86%, respectively, the rate of BP control was low at 37%. Furthermore, there remained a high degree of unawareness

The stability of an Captopril oral solution prepared from tablets

open access: yesJournal of Health Science and Medical Research (JHSMR), 2006
Objective: To develop extemporaneous captopril oral solution 1 mg/ml for use in child patients at Songklanagarind Hospital. The formulation was prepared from commercially available 25 mg captopril tablet.

Application of new ferrocene derivative for electrocatalytic determination of captopril using multiwall carbon nanotube modified carbon paste electrode

open access: yesBulletin of the Chemical Society of Ethiopia, 2015
A carbon-paste electrode modified with the N-4,4'-azodianiline (ferrocenyl Schiff base) and with multiwall carbon nanotubes was used as a highly sensitive and fairly selective electrochemical sensor for trace level determination of captopril.
